Excel表格是一個常用的數據處理工具,可以幫助我們對數據進行整理、分析和展示。而JSON則是一種輕量級的數據交換格式,已經成為了Web開發中最常用的數據格式之一。所以如果想要把Excel中的數據轉換成JSON格式,就需要用到Excel轉JSON的JS工具。
function excelToJson(file) { var workbook = XLSX.readFile(file); var sheet_name_list = workbook.SheetNames; var json = {}; sheet_name_list.forEach(function(sheetName) { var worksheet = workbook.Sheets[sheetName]; json[sheetName] = XLSX.utils.sheet_to_json(worksheet); }); return json; }
這是一個excel轉JSON的JS函數,其中用到了一個叫做XLSX的JS庫。這個庫可以幫助我們讀取和寫入Excel文件,并且轉換成JSON格式。在這個函數中,我們首先讀取Excel文件,然后獲取每個表格中的數據,并將數據轉換成JSON格式。最后,我們將所有的表格的JSON數據存儲到一個JSON對象中,最后返回這個對象。
使用這個函數非常簡單,在使用之前,你需要先引入XLSX庫。然后你只需要調用這個函數,并傳入你的Excel文件,就可以得到一個JSON對象了。
var file = 'data.xlsx'; var json = excelToJson(file); console.log(json); // 打印JSON對象
使用Excel轉JSON的JS工具,可以讓我們更方便地把Excel中的數據轉換成JSON格式,從而方便地在Web開發中使用。